A unique strength of DIALux Pro is its sophisticated daylight calculation engine. It can simulate the impact of windows, skylights, and shading devices, analyzing how natural light contributes to the overall illumination throughout the day and across seasons. This functionality is critical for designing sustainable buildings that maximize energy savings and enhance occupant well-being through dynamic, biologically effective lighting.

Compiling a comprehensive lighting submittal report can take hours of manual formatting. The Pro version’s automated Excel export and pre-saved PDF layout templates reduce compilation time to minutes.
